While Ryan Jeffers remains the New York Yankees’ top target for catcher before the start of the trade deadline, more interesting names have come to light.

According to ESPN’s Jorge Castillo, there are some logical upgrades for the Yankees, including an All-Star from the league’s last-placed team.

“The Yankees need a catcher. With Austin Wells, J.C. Escarra and Ali Sanchez, Yankees catchers rank last in baseball in OPS and wRC+,” Castillo wrote.

“It is the most glaring weakness on the roster. There are two obvious potential upgrades via trade: Ryan Jeffers of the Minnesota Twins and Hunter Goodman, the Colorado Rockies’ lone All-Star.”

Goodman leads the MLB at his position with 27 home runs and has been stronger on the road than in the hitter-friendly Coors Field.

Given how much Austin Wells has struggled, in addition to the Yankies and the Rockies making several trades over the years, this could be the latest blockbuster signing.

Apart from Castillo, Mike Asixa of CBS Sports believes Goodman would be a huge upgrade for the Yankees at catcher. However, a former contact between the parties is yet to be made.

“The Yankees have shown interest in Rockies All-Star catcher Hunter Goodman in the past, reports ESPN,” Axisa wrote.

Multiple reports have also been circulating around the Yankees potentially including Spencer Jones as a wildcard in this trade deal. While he strikes out a ton, it is rare to see a player with his power and athleticism.

“The two teams have not spoken recently, however. New York’s catchers have been simply dreadful this season. They rank 29th in batting average (.175) and on-base percentage (.250), 30th in slugging percentage (.269), and 26th with 0.2 WAR.” Axisa added.

But it is clear that the Yankees are not rushing with Goodman at catcher and are primarily treating him as a secondary target. But given how much the Yankees have struggled this season at pitcher, there are bound to be other options.

Other Potential Targets for Yankees at Catcher

The Yankees could be taking a careful approach to pursuing Goodman, with close to two weeks left before the trade deadline and other potential additions on the market.

Former MLB player and now analyst Trevor Plouffe suggested Arizona Diamondbacks catcher Gabriel Moreno. San Diego Padres closer Mason Miller is another name heavily mentioned in the Yankees’ trade rumors.

While the Yankees have other areas certainly to improve upon, many insiders believe catcher is the biggest area of need, which has escalated further by the absence of slugger Aaron Judge, who is expected to miss several more weeks as he recovers from a rib injury.
